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ation. The primary goal is to create a protective barrier that prevents moisture from penetrating the concrete, thereby reducing the risk of water intrusion and damage. These services often include sur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airing cracks, followed by the application of high-quality sealants designed to withstand the conditions specific to the property. Proper sealing can help extend the lifespan of the foundation and maintain the structural integrity of the building.
One of the main issues that foundation sealing addresses is water infiltration. Excess moisture can lead to a variety of problems, including basement flooding, mold growth, and deterioration of the concrete over time. Sealing the foundation helps control moisture levels, minimizing the likelihood of water-related issues that can compromise the stability of the structure. Additionally, sealing can prevent the ingress of pests and reduce the risk of efflorescence, which is the formation of salt deposits on the surface of the concrete caused by water movement.

Cost Range for Sealing - The typical cost for concrete foundation sealing services varies between $500 and $2,500, depending on the size and condition of the foundation. For a standard residential basement, prices often fall around $1,200. Larger or more complex projects may cost more, with some exceeding $3,000.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s are affected by the foundation’s size, accessibility, and the type of sealant used. For example, sealing a small crawl space may be closer to $500, while expansive foundations can reach $2,000 or more. Additional prep work or repairs can also increase the overall price.
Average Cost per Square Foot - Many service providers charge between $1 and $3 per square foot for sealing concrete foundations. A typical 1,000-square-foot basement might cost between $1,000 and $3,000. Prices can vary based on regional rates and project specifics.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ying protective coatings or sealants to prevent moisture infiltration and protect the foundation from water damage.
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help reduce water penetration, prevent cracks caused by moisture expansion, and extend the lifespan of the foundation.
How often does a foundation need to be sealed? The frequency of sealing depends on climate and soil conditions, but generally, it may be recommended every few years by local contractors.
What types of sealants are used for foundation sealing? Common sealants include waterproof coatings, epoxy-based sealants, and elastomeric sealants, selected based on specific needs and conditions.
